So… Where does the name “Kai Kotch” come from?

 

Kotch” (often also spelled “cotch”) is a Western Caribbean slang term used either as:

· a verb meaning “to relax” or “to ’hang out’ and relax with others”  or “to sit and chill out”

or

· a noun meaning “a relaxing place” or “a comfortable seat”

Tim and Tonya Adam discovered a great “kotch” in Rum Point on Grand Cayman, tucked away in a tranquil cove that is part of the well-known Cayman Kai development.  Tim was born in Jamaica but grew up on Grand Cayman — his Mom is a Caymanian whose family have been in the island since its earliest settlement.  Tonya was born in Texas and also lived in Illinois, North Carolina, and back in Texas before marrying the island boy and moving to the islands.

 

Tim’s grandfather Cap’n Bertie as he was affectionately known, was a true Caymanian seaman having the ability to build, rig, and sail the wooden schooners for which the island was known.  He spent much of his working life as a “hard-hat diver”, working from his shipyard in the port of Colón, Panama, on the Caribbean side of the “Canal Zone”.  If you visit the new tourist attraction Pedro St.James, look for the “Steadman Bodden House” and homesite on the western side of the grounds.  That traditional wattle-and-daub house stood for about a century on Mary Street in George Town, and was built by Cap’n Bertie’s father Steadman, who was nicknamed “Mac Iron”.  Tim spent the first few years of his life in that same home in its original location on Mary Street, with his brothers, parents, grandparents, and a generous sprinkling of cousins.
